  1. Hori (ホリ, born 11 February 1977, in Shiroi (formerly Inba District, Shiroi), Chiba Prefecture) is a Japanese impressionist (monomane tarento). His real name is Hirohito Hori (堀 裕人, Hori Hirohito). Hori is represented with Horipro Com of Horipro.

  4. HORI7ON is the final 7 members of the survival show Dream Maker under MLD Entertainment, ABS-CBN, and KAMP Korea. The group consists of Vinci, Kim, Kyler, Reyster, Winston, Jeromy, and Marcus. They were trained in South Korea and debuted as a global pop group.

    It was founded in 1960 as Hori Productions (ホリプロダクション Hori Purodakushon) and changed to its present name in 1990. Horipro has two locations in the United States: Nashville and Los Angeles. In the 1970s, one of Hori Productions' most famous stars was singer Momoe Yamaguchi.

  7. 1 day ago · Almost five years after Valve stopped making the Steam Controller, a new officially licenced gamepad for Steam is coming out soon. Japanese gaming peripherals manufacturer Hori has announced the Wireless Horipad for Steam. It mimics the Steam Deck's menu buttons, and features touch sensors on its sticks for gyro control.
